What is Enhanced Intel® SpeedStep® Technology?

0

Enhanced Intel® SpeedStep® Technology provides desktop class performance with all the benefits of mobility. This is accomplished with two dynamically switching performance modes. Maximum Performance mode provides desktop-class performance when you are connected to AC power, while Battery Optimized mode delivers maximum battery life. For example, when a system is unplugged, the Mobile Intel® Pentium® 4 Processor – M 1.70 GHz core automatically drops to 1.20 GHz from the peak frequency of 1.70 GHz. At the same time, the operating voltage of the processor drops to 1.20 volts from 1.30 volts. In addition, Enhanced Intel® SpeedStep® Technology software allows for automatic or user controlled performance mode switching. The software supports all the major operating systems including Microsoft’s Windows* 95, Windows 98, Windows NT 4.0, Windows 2000, and Windows XP through a common code base.
